South Carolina Payroll Employment By County for The Private Goods Producing Industry in May, 2019
Updated on October 9, 2022.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in May, 2019, South Carolina added 1,258 number of jobs to the private goods-producing industry. Among South Carolina counties, Beaufort added the highest number of jobs (422), followed by Spartanburg (324), and Charleston (275).
